    1 Star - Defective Work, No Contract, Avoided Responsibility…read moreI hired Long Island Mason & Concrete Corp in June 2024 to pour a concrete patio for $5,900. The experience was a nightmare from start to finish. The Problems: The contractor requested payment in cash and never provided a written contract, which is required by New York law for jobs over $500. Within one week of the pour, two slabs began flaking and scaling. I immediately contacted the contractor. The work was done on a 100-degree day. When I raised concerns about the extreme heat affecting the concrete, the contractor acknowledged "this is the result of extreme heat" but refused to take responsibility as the professional who should have managed weather conditions or rescheduled. Months of Delays: Instead of promptly addressing the defects, the contractor stalled for months. When he finally offered to replace the two damaged slabs, he demanded I sign a liability waiver and warned the new concrete wouldn't match the color of the existing slabs - meaning I'd have a permanently mismatched patio due to his defective work. I offered a reasonable cash settlement to resolve the issue. He refused. I had no choice but to file a complaint with Nassau County Consumer Affairs. Official Violations: Consumer Affairs cited the contractor for multiple violations, including failure to provide a written contract (violation 202360, originally a $2,500 fine). He only agreed to a settlement after facing thousands in fines and potential license suspension. Ongoing Defects: After settling, two additional slabs developed structural cracks running completely across the slabs from joint to joint. All four slabs now show defects, confirming my original concern that the entire pour was compromised. Bottom Line: For a $5,900 job, I received a defective patio that required a 7-month battle through Consumer Affairs to get partial compensation. The contractor operates without proper contracts, pours in extreme conditions without adequate precautions, and avoids responsibility when problems arise. I strongly recommend hiring a licensed contractor who provides written contracts, follows proper procedures, and stands behind their work. This is not that contractor.

    We are happy to recommend Diamond. Our basement had been leaking on and off since we moved in and…read morewe needed it waterproofed. Long story short Diamond Masonary was great. They finished the job in two days and were fairly priced. It's been about a month and we haven't seen a leak yet despite all the snow and rain. If we do I will update. Give them a call. They didn't reflect the negative reviews I read on here. If you want the full details read on. Vinny came to our house and was very detailed in explaining what he thought the problem was and how he would fix it. He listened to my questions (I tend to have a lot) and didn't try to upsell us. I assumed the problem would need a French drain and more and he felt confident that we didn't need to go to that expense. He said he could do all of that but we would be fine with an exterior membrane. I met with two other waterproofers who pretty much said the same and Vinny was the middle quote -yet we still chose him because he was honest and down to earth. Also I liked that his sons do the work so I trust they will take care to do it right. They scheduled us pretty quickly and got to work right away at 7 am. Three of them hand dug a 25 ft x 9 ft trench over two days (originally was supposed to be one but they needed a second because of our collapsing soil). They sealed the foundation and took care to replace my window wells, put my Sprinkler lines back, and stack the pavers they had to remove. They were respectful to me and my neighbors and didn't mind me hawking over to see them work every once and a while. We were very pleased with their work would recommend them.
